Buying Guide: Key Purchase Considerations
When evaluating flow valves and boiler fill/backflow devices, consider the following factors to ensure compatibility and reliability:
- Application and compatibility: Confirm the valve’s connection type (NPT, female/male threads), size (typically 1/2″ for boilers), and whether it matches your boiler manufacturer’s recommendations.
- Backflow prevention vs. fill control: Decide whether you need a dedicated backflow preventer, a combined fill valve with backflow protection, or an automatic fill valve with gauge. Some products emphasize leak protection, others emphasize quick filling or precise pressure control.
- Pressure and temperature ratings: Check maximum working pressure (psi or bar) and temperature range to ensure safe operation under boiler startup, cycling, and potential surge conditions.
- Materials and durability: Brass bodies with stainless steel internals offer corrosion resistance and longer life. Look for robust seals and an integral filter where applicable.
- Maintenance and serviceability: Favor designs with accessible service components, clear gauges, and straightforward purge capabilities to minimize downtime during maintenance.
- Environment and application: For commercial or dairy/processing settings, ensure the valve is rated for the specific fluids and temperatures. For laboratories or sterile environments, compact size and cleanability can be important.
- Brand support and compatibility: Choose reputable brands with wide compatibility and clear installation instructions. Availability of replacement parts is a practical consideration for long-term upkeep.
